Is Green for Real in China?
An open forum to switch ideas and find insights into consumer purchasing behavior in China
The driver....
This forum is being driven by the 'Consumer Insight Focus Group,'a core group of members who are interested in creating an interactive,informative and inspiring event that is not a lecture hall, or a place where you find ppts or involves a sales pitch. The group includes: Penny Burgess, General Manager, Ketchum Newscan Public Relations; Lynette Lu, PR and Marketing Supervisor, Virgin Atlantic Airways; Crystal Qian, Head of Marketing, Consumer Banking, Standard Charted Bank; Amena Schlaikjer, Dara MacCaba, Christopher Ruane, ?What If! and Byron Constable, President, Wanmo.
The format and themes....
The forum will be facilitated by one of these members and will be comprised of 20 senior executives and marketeers. Participants will be expected to both contribute to and draw from its collective value by offering their own experiences, heard stories, new ideas and potential solutions. Each meeting will have a theme such as; Luxury, Green Living, Healthcare, Media, Education etc., which will be set at the previous meeting. Attendees will submit an insight, issue, challenge, problem, project idea etc relating to the theme 3 days before the meeting. The event series will take place on the second Tuesday of every Month. The next session will be held on 8 July with a discussion theme: Is Green for Real in China?
